JS获取URL信息类主要功能有:1.获取URL基本信息,包括:网址,协议,端口号等。2.地址栏获取参数。3.将json格式的参数对象转换成字符串。 //获取URL信息 var shaoURL = shaoURL || {}; (function (n){ var d = { pathname:window.location.pathname, //设置或获取
# JavaScript 调用接口及使用 new URL 在现代Web开发中,JavaScript与API的交互是非常重要的一个环节。无论是与后端服务器进行数据交换,还是与第三方服务进行通信,了解如何有效地调用接口都是每一个开发者所需掌握的技能。本文将详尽介绍JavaScript调用接口的方法,特别是使用 `new URL()` 来构建请求URL。同时,我们还将通过可视化饼状图和关系图更好地理解
原创 2024-09-24 04:47:45
168阅读
javascript获取url信息的常见方法
转载 2023-06-06 07:43:02
131阅读
前段时间公司做了个比较大的项目,需要用到ocx控件,我厂大部分项目都采用C#.net,而winform程序条用ocx控件接口是相对简单的,但是javascript调用ocx接口,却和winform的用法有些不同,其实真捉摸下,也就能发现:差别不大。笔者此次主要阐述在项目中用javascript调用ocx控件接口,也就是activeX控件时所遇到的问题及其解决方案。winform用法不在此篇中阐述。
想要获取指定的url的header头,只能在拦截器过滤。 一开始准备直接过滤所有的拦截信息然后把需要的url信息存到本地, 再通过再次在页面请求接口保存header头Vue.http.interceptors.push(function(request, next) { if(request.url.indexOf('slice/by/pathology')!== -1){ sessi
转载 2023-06-06 09:43:56
161阅读
# 用JavaScript调用带有重定向参数的URL 在现代Web开发中,JavaScript被广泛应用于前端开发,尤其是在处理URL重定向时。本篇文章旨在帮助刚入行的小白掌握如何用JavaScript调用带有重定向参数的URL。我们会先概述整个流程,然后逐步详细探讨每一个步骤。 ## 流程概述 我们将整个过程分为以下几个步骤: | 步骤 | 描述 | |------|------| |
原创 2024-09-04 06:06:44
222阅读
# URLJavaScript ## 1. 介绍 URL(Uniform Resource Locator)是用于定位和访问互联网资源的地址。在Web开发中,我们经常需要使用URL来发送请求、导航页面或执行其他操作。JavaScript是一种广泛应用于Web开发的编程语言,它可以通过操作URL来实现各种功能。 本文将介绍如何在JavaScript中使用URL,并提供一些常见的应用示例。
原创 2023-08-09 18:57:20
47阅读
URL: 统一资源定位符 (Uniform Resource Locator, URL) 完整的URL由这几个部分构成: scheme://host:port/path?query#fragment scheme = 通信协议 (常用的http,ftp,maito等) host = 主机 (域名或IP) port = 端口号 pat
一.<script> urlinfo=window.location.href; //获取当前页面的url len=urlinfo.length;//获取url的长度 offset=urlinfo.indexOf("?");//设置参数字符串开始的位置 newsidinfo=urlinfo.substr(offset,len)//取出参数字符串 这里会获得类似“id=1”这样的字符串
转载 2023-06-25 09:55:41
62阅读
快速提示:使用JavaScript获取URL参数 译者:kayson 你想从URL里获取参数? URL参数(也叫查询字符串参数获URL变量)可包含很多有用的数据,如产品信息、用户偏好、链接来源等等。让我们开始吧!获取URL参数假设你有如下的url:`http://example.com/?product=shirt&color=blue&newuser&size=m`这
有时我们需要在客户端获取url参数,而javascript没有提供类似getQueryString的函  数。所以我们就得自己写个咯!   今天介绍两种获取链接(url)参数的方法:  第一种用正则匹配的方式:function getQueryString(url, name) { var reg = new RegExp("(^|\\?|&)" + name + "=([^&]*
转载 2023-05-26 15:40:56
56阅读
在开发Web应用程序时,如何有效地进行JavaScript URL转码处理是一个不可忽视的问题。URL转码的目的是确保在传输过程中,URL中的特定字符能够安全地被处理,避免因非法字符导致的错误。然而,转码和解码过程的复杂性,往往给开发带来了不少挑战。本篇文章将深入探讨JavaScript URL转码的相关技术,包括业务场景分析,技术演进,架构设计等内容。 ## 背景定位 在现代Web应用中,U
# JavaScript URL 下载实现指南 今天,我们将一起学习如何在 JavaScript 中实现 URL 下载。这对于需要自动化下载文件的开发者来说非常有用。以下是整个流程的简介以及每一步的详细说明。 ## 流程概述 下表展示了整个实现过程中的步骤: | 步骤编号 | 操作说明 | |----------|------------------
原创 2024-10-25 06:10:18
253阅读
# JavaScript URL 正则表达式 在开发 Web 应用程序时,我们经常需要验证和处理 URLURL 是统一资源定位符的缩写,是用于定位和访问互联网上资源的地址。JavaScript 提供了正则表达式(RegExp)来处理 URL 字符串,并进行验证、解析和提取。 ## URL 的组成部分 一个标准的 URL 由以下几个部分组成: 1. 协议(Protocol):如 `http
原创 2023-08-06 19:09:00
149阅读
# URL, JSON, and JavaScript: A Comprehensive Guide ![Class Diagram](class_diagram.png) ## Introduction In the world of web development, the combination of URL, JSON, and JavaScript plays a crucial
原创 2023-12-07 08:16:21
18阅读
# 如何实现“JavaScript URL Replace” ## 1. 介绍 作为一名经验丰富的开发者,我们经常需要处理 URL 地址的替换操作。在 JavaScript 中,我们可以通过使用 `window.location.replace()` 方法来实现这一功能。本文将教你如何利用这个方法来替换网页的 URL 地址。 ## 2. 实现流程 首先,我们需要了解实现这一功能的整体流程。下面
原创 2024-06-14 05:18:04
41阅读
# JavaScript URL验证 在Web开发中,URL(统一资源定位符)是用于标识和定位互联网上的资源的字符串。在JavaScript中,我们经常需要验证用户输入的URL是否符合规范。本文将介绍如何使用JavaScript来验证URL,并提供代码示例。 ## 什么是URLURL是一种标准化的字符串格式,用于在互联网上定位资源。它通常由以下几个部分组成: - 协议(Protocol
原创 2023-08-08 10:09:31
174阅读
# 如何实现JavaScript URL参数 ## 概述 在Web开发中,URL参数是一种常见的传递数据的方式。通过URL参数,我们可以在不同页面之间传递数据,或者在同一页面中根据参数的不同展示不同的内容。在JavaScript中,我们可以通过解析URL参数的方法来获取并处理这些参数。 ## 实现步骤 下面是实现JavaScript URL参数的步骤: | 步骤 | 描述 | | --- |
原创 2023-08-07 05:15:46
118阅读
# JavaScript分析URL:深入理解和应用 在Web开发中,URL扮演着至关重要的角色。它不仅用于定位资源,而且还携带了很多信息,例如查询参数、路径和锚点等。在JavaScript中分析和处理URL可以帮助我们更好地理解和操作Web应用。本文将详细介绍如何使用JavaScript分析URL,并提供相应的代码示例。 ## URL的基础知识 URL(统一资源定位符)通常遵循以下格式:
原创 10月前
46阅读
# 学习如何获取当前 URL 的简单指南 作为一名新手开发者,学习如何获取当前网页的 URL 是非常重要的一步。这不仅仅是一个基本的技能,还可以帮助你在后续开发中处理很多与 URL 有关的操作。本文将详细讲解如何使用 JavaScript 获取当前 URL,并为你提供一个清晰的流程和代码示例。 ## 流程概述 下面是获取当前 URL 的基本步骤: | 步骤 | 描述 | | ---- |
  • 1
  • 2
  • 3
  • 4
  • 5